Working principle:
When doing the exercise of bent leg, biggish resistance exercise is needed.In the case where load-carrying block 29 is constant, it is only necessary to be inserted into second
Pin 9, fixed plate 7 only links with the first fixed disk 5 by the way that the second pin 9 is fixed at this time, and user's song leg drives L shape fixed link
13 rotate, and fixed plate 7 and the first fixed disk 5 is driven to move in L shape fixed link 13.First fixed disk 5 drive the second drawstring 23, from
And the first movable pulley 20, third movable pulley 22, the 4th drawstring 25 are driven, lift load-carrying block 29.Due at this time in the second drawstring 23
In being combined with the movable pulley of the 4th drawstring 25, the second drawstring 23 be used as resistance arm, so power needed for lifting identical load-carrying block 29 compared with
Greatly, meet required resistance when bent leg.
It does and stretches one's legs when taking exercise, need lesser resistance exercise.In the case where load-carrying block 29 is constant, the second pin need to be only extracted
Nail 9 is inserted into the first pin 8, and fixed plate 7 and the second fixed disk 6 link by the way that the first pin 8 is fixed at this time.User stretches one's legs band
Dynamic L shape fixed link 13 rotates, and fixed plate 7 and the second fixed disk 6 is driven to move in L shape fixed link 13.Second fixed disk 6 drives the
Three drawstrings 24, to driving third movable pulley 22, the 4th drawstring 25, lift load-carrying block 29.Due at this time third drawstring 24 with
In the movable pulley combination of 4th drawstring 25, third drawstring 24 is used as power arm, so power needed for lifting identical load-carrying block 29 is smaller,
Satisfaction required resistance when stretching one's legs.The first arc groove 11 in first fixed disk 5 will limit fixed plate 7 in motion process,
To be limited to the rotational angle of L shape fixed link 13, the amplitude of swing of leg can be limited.
